    Stella by Starlight by Sharon M. Draper is about a girl named Stella and her journey as a young black girl in town inhabited by the KKK. She has to always be wary, on edge, and faces many hardships and unjust events. Throughout she remains strong and helps support her family through the tough times. I really liked reading this book even though it made me sad to think that this rascism still happens today. It made me wish that everyone could just accept each other and hold each other up like they do in this book. I would reccomend it to lovers of great historical fiction.

    West of the Moon by Margi Preus is a really good book that is sort of a play on the folktale "East of the Sun, West of the Moon." It is about two girls who try to run away from their evil goatman master. It's really amazing and I really liked reading it. "I want to do what's right. But how can I, when I am faced with only impossible choices?” ― Margi Preus, West of the Moon
